March Court
1737
208 form as by the Information afd above against her Supposed and the premisses in the Information afd Expressly acknowledgeth whereupon all and Singular the premisses being Seen and by the Court here fully understood It is Considered that the aforesaid Elizabeth Longo pay unto his said Lordship the Lord Proprietary for her fine by the Court here upon her Imposed for and by occasion of the premisses afd whereof in form aforesaid she is Convict thirty Shillings Curr.t Money of Maryland (to the Use of the County afd) and that the Said Elizabeth Longo be taken to satisfie his said Lordship of the fine &a Thereupon Elizabeth Longo is ordered to give security for the payment of the severall officers fees due by means of the premisses and Indictment af.d &a Whereupon the said Elizabeth Longo with James Longo of Somerset County planter ^her security^ present herein Court in their proper persons acknowledged ^themselves^ Indebted unto the severall officers fees due of Somerset County Court that hath a right to any fee or fees on the Indictment and premisses af.d In Five hundred pounds of tobacco of their bodys goods or Chattles Lands or tenements to the use of the severall officers af.d their heirs or assignes to be made and levied In case the said Elizabeth Longo do not pay and satisfie unto the severall officers af.d their Just and rightfull fee or fees on the Indictment and premisses af.d &a
